Using design thinking methodology, a two-year curriculum development project at FHNW University of Applied Sciences and Arts Northwestern Switzerland explored ways of supporting individual learning processes. Focussing on the Bachelor programme at FHNW School of Social Work, the project was being conducted in collaboration with partners from FHNW School of Engineering and Basel Academy of Art and Design FHNW. The co-creative project design made it possible to collect and bundle students’ and lecturers’ existing experiences and expertise concerning individual learning processes and then combine these into a corresponding concept. The result is a set of proposals for implementing the findings in educational formats at the FHNW.
